## 👥 Built for three audiences

### 🛡️ Site owners & beginners — safety and clarity

| Feature | What it does | Why it matters |
|--------|--------------|----------------|
| **Safe Mode** (`--safe-mode`) | Caps request rate (~2 req/s), uses an honest User-Agent, lowers concurrency, and respects `robots.txt` | Protects small sites from accidental overload and keeps audits polite |
| **Robots.txt respect** | Crawler skips disallowed paths by default | Helps beginners scan only what the site owner permits |
| **Colour-coded findings** | Terminal output uses severity colours (critical → info) | Spot the worst issues first without reading raw logs |
| **`--explain` mode** | Plain-language explanation under each finding | Beginners understand *why* something is a problem and *how* to fix it |
| **Confidence dimension** | Every finding is tagged `firm` / `tentative` / `informational` | Filter `--min-confidence firm` to see only directly-verified findings |

```bash
webscan -t https://yoursite.com --safe-mode --explain
```

### 🥷 Bug hunters — stealth and depth

| Feature | What it does | Why it matters |
|--------|--------------|----------------|
| **Request jitter** (`--random-delay`) | Randomises pause between requests (×0.5–×1.5) | Blurs automated traffic patterns against basic WAF rules |
| **User-Agent rotation** (`--random-agent`) | Rotates browser-like signatures (Chrome, Firefox, mobile) | Bypasses blocks on scanner fingerprints; probes mobile variants |
| **Proxy / SOCKS5** (`--proxy`) | Routes all traffic through Burp, Tor, or any HTTP/SOCKS proxy | Keeps your real IP off the target's logs |
| **Soft-404 filter** (`--soft-404`) | Calibrates against a bogus path, drops directory/file hits that just echo the server's "not found" page | Kills the false-positive flood on sites that answer `200` for everything |
| **Retry with backoff** | Transient `5xx`/`429` responses ride out with exponential backoff | A flaky 502/503 no longer aborts the whole scan |
| **Active plugins probe 5 headers** | `Host`, `X-Forwarded-Host`, `X-Original-URL`, `X-Rewrite-URL`, `X-Forwarded-Server` | Catches cache-poisoning and host-header injection variants |

```bash
webscan -t https://target.com --proxy socks5://127.0.0.1:9050 --random-agent --random-delay --soft-404
```

### 🧬 Responsible disclosure — ethics and privacy

| Feature | What it does | Why it matters |
|--------|--------------|----------------|
| **Legal disclaimer** | Printed at startup in interactive mode | Makes authorised-use explicit; discourages misuse |
| **Report anonymisation** (`--anonymize`) | Strips local paths, hostname, username, and private IPs from exports | Safer SARIF/JSON sharing; GDPR-friendly data minimisation |
| **Passive-first design** | 8 of 38 plugins are passive (no probes sent) — `headers`, `cookies`, `cors`, `ssl_tls`, `tech_fingerprint`, `security_txt`, `robots_sitemap`, `jwt_audit` | Site owners can audit configuration exposure without sending a single probe |

```bash
webscan -t https://example.com --format sarif json -o report --anonymize
```

## 🧩 Plugins

**38 plugins** — each content-verified to keep the false-positive rate low.

| Plugin | Type | Checks |
|--------|------|--------|
| `config_files` | active | 50+ exposed files: `.env`, `.git/config`, `wp-config.php`, SSH keys, SQL dumps |
| `secrets` | passive | Leaked API keys in HTML/JS: AWS, Anthropic, OpenAI, Stripe, GitHub, Slack, JWTs, generic `api_key=` (redacted) |
| `headers` | passive | CSP, HSTS, X-Frame-Options, X-Content-Type-Options, Referrer-Policy, Permissions-Policy |
| `directories` | active | `/admin`, `/backup`, `/.git/`, phpMyAdmin and open directory listings |
| `sql_injection` | active | Error-based, **boolean-blind** and **time-blind** — MySQL / PostgreSQL / MSSQL / Oracle |
| `xss` | active | Reflected XSS in query parameters with injection-context classification |
| `path_traversal` | active | `../../../etc/passwd`, `windows/win.ini` and encoded variants |
| `open_redirect` | active | `?next=`, `?redirect=`, `?url=` — **13 payload variants** (absolute, protocol-relative, backslash, triple-slash, URL-encoded, CRLF); content-verified via `Location` host |
| `ssrf` | active | AWS/GCP metadata & localhost probes (response-signature based) |
| `cors` | passive | Reflected `Origin`, wildcard `*`, credentials exposure |
| `cookies` | passive | Missing `Secure` / `HttpOnly` / `SameSite` flags |
| `http_methods` | active | Dangerous methods enabled: `PUT`, `DELETE`, `TRACE`, `CONNECT`, `PATCH` |
| `ssl_tls` | passive | Weak protocols (SSLv2/3, TLS 1.0/1.1), expired/expiring certs, missing HSTS |
| `security_txt` | passive | security.txt presence, format, and best-practice fields |
| `tech_fingerprint` | passive | Server / framework / CMS detection from headers, cookies & HTML |
| `subdomains` | active | DNS brute force + Certificate Transparency logs (crt.sh) |
| `robots_sitemap` | passive | robots.txt / sitemap.xml hygiene + sensitive paths leaked via Disallow |
| `graphql` | active | GraphQL endpoints with introspection enabled (schema disclosure) — *opt-in* |
| `cve_lookup` | active | Maps detected software/versions to known CVEs via NVD, linked to [cve.org](https://www.cve.org) — *opt-in* |
| `jwt_audit` | passive | `alg=none`, weak HMAC secrets, missing/expired `exp`, sensitive claims, `kid`/`jku`/`x5u` injection vectors |
| `csrf` | passive | POST/PUT/PATCH forms missing CSRF tokens (skips login/search, respects `<meta csrf-token>` + SameSite cookies) |
| `lfi_rfi` | active | Path-traversal + PHP wrappers (`php://filter`); **content-verified** — only flags when actual file markers (`root:x:0:0:`, `[fonts]`) are present; soft-404 + file-not-found suppression |
| `xxe` | active | XML endpoints probed with internal + external entity payloads; per-scan random marker; only INFO for XML/JSON responses (not HTML error pages) |
| `idor` | active | API endpoints (`/api/`, `/v1/`, …) probed with ±1 object IDs; similarity ≥0.85 + length ratio 0.5–2.0 + object-id equality check + soft-404 + auth-error marker suppression |
| `clickjacking` | passive | Missing `X-Frame-Options` and `CSP frame-ancestors`; flags `ALLOW-FROM` (obsolete); LOW when only legacy header present |
| `cache_poisoning` | active | `Host`, `X-Forwarded-Host`, `X-Original-URL`, `X-Rewrite-URL`, `X-Forwarded-Server` — CRITICAL when reflected in `<link>`/`<script>`/`<a href>`/`<form action>`; MEDIUM for plain-text reflection |
| `host_header_injection` | active | Password-reset endpoints (`/reset`, `/forgot`, `/wp-login.php?action=lostpassword`, …) — CRITICAL when injected host appears in URL; HIGH for plain reflection; INFO for blind poisoning |

> Run `webscan --list-plugins` to see them all, or pick a subset with `--plugins`.
>
> **Opt-in plugins** (`graphql`, `cve_lookup`) make extra/external requests, so
> they're excluded from the default run — enable them explicitly, e.g.
> `--plugins cve_lookup graphql`. Plugins are discovered via the
> `webscan.plugins` [entry-point group](pyproject.toml), so third-party packages
> can register their own.

### Confidence dimension

Every finding carries a **confidence** tag alongside its severity:

| Confidence | Meaning | When to use |
|------------|---------|-------------|
| `firm` | Directly observed / proven — payload reflected, file marker matched, header literally absent | Default — these are real |
| `tentative` | Heuristic — strong signal but needs manual confirmation (e.g. response-size delta, algorithm-confusion hint) | `--min-confidence firm` filters these out |
| `informational` | Best-practice note or "manual review needed" (e.g. XML endpoint accepts POST without echoing entity) | `--min-confidence tentative` filters these out |

```bash
# Only directly-verified findings (strongest false-positive filter)
webscan -t https://example.com --min-confidence firm
```

## 🗂️ Config profiles

Keep reusable scan settings in a YAML file instead of long command lines. CLI
flags always override file values, which override the built-in defaults.

```yaml
# webscan.yml — named profiles, selected with --profile
profiles:
  quick:
    plugins: [headers, cookies, ssl_tls]
    concurrency: 30
  deep:
    plugins: [headers, sql_injection, xss, ssrf, cve_lookup]
    crawl: true
    depth: 3
    format: [json, sarif]
```

```bash
webscan -t https://example.com --config webscan.yml --profile deep
# Override a single value from the profile:
webscan -t https://example.com --config webscan.yml --profile deep --concurrency 5
```

A flat file (keys at the top level, no `profiles:`) is treated as a single
default profile. Recognised keys: `plugins`, `concurrency`, `timeout`, `format`,
`output`, `crawl`, `depth`, `max_urls`, `scope`, `exclude`, `min_severity`,
`min_confidence`, `fail_on`, `safe_mode`, `delay`, `rate_limit`, `retries`,
`retry_backoff`, `verbose`, `quiet`, `anonymize`.

---

## 📊 Output formats

| Format | Flag | Use case |
|--------|------|----------|
| JSON | `--format json` | CI/CD, scripting, integrations |
| JSON Lines | `--format jsonl` | `jq`/`grep` pipelines — one finding per line |
| Markdown | `--format md` | Human review, GitHub PRs |
| HTML | `--format html` | Self-contained stakeholder reports |
| SARIF | `--format sarif` | GitHub Code Scanning, VS Code |
| CSV | `--format csv` | Excel, Jira, Notion |

**CI-friendly:** WebScan exits with code `1` when any CRITICAL or HIGH finding is detected.

## 📦 Library mode

WebScan is usable directly from Python — embed it in a recon pipeline, a
notebook, or CI glue without shelling out to the CLI:

```python
import asyncio
import webscan

# Async (native):
report = asyncio.run(webscan.scan(["https://example.com"]))

# Blocking convenience for scripts / notebooks:
report = webscan.scan_sync(
    ["https://example.com"],
    plugins=["headers", "cookies", "config_files"],
    soft_404=True,
)

for tr in report.targets:
    for f in tr.findings:
        print(f.severity.value, f.confidence.value, f.plugin, f.title)
```

`scan()` / `scan_sync()` return the same `ScanReport` the CLI uses, so you can
render it in any format with `Reporter`:

```python
from webscan import Reporter

Reporter(report).to_jsonl("findings.jsonl")   # or to_json / to_sarif / to_html ...
```

`webscan.scan` accepts `plugins`, `concurrency`, `timeout`, `soft_404`,
`proxy`, `auth_headers`, `auth_cookies`, `on_progress`, `min_confidence`
and more — see its docstring. `webscan.ALL_PLUGINS` / `webscan.DEFAULT_PLUGINS`
list what's available.

---

## 🔌 Writing a plugin

```python
from __future__ import annotations
import aiohttp
from webscan.models import Confidence, Finding, Severity
from webscan.plugins.base import BasePlugin

class MyPlugin(BasePlugin):
    name = "my_plugin"
    description = "What it checks in one line"

    async def run(self, target: str, session: aiohttp.ClientSession) -> list[Finding]:
        findings: list[Finding] = []
        # ... perform checks, append Finding(...) objects ...
        # Use Confidence.FIRM for directly-observed results,
        # Confidence.TENTATIVE for heuristics,
        # Confidence.INFORMATIONAL for "manual review needed".
        return findings
```

Register it in `webscan/registry.py` → add it to `_BUILTIN_PLUGINS`, or ship it
in your own package under the `webscan.plugins` entry-point group. Done.

For active plugins that send probes, use the shared helpers in
`webscan/plugins/_active_helpers.py` (`fetch_with_retry`, `fetch_with_headers`,
`calibrate_target`, `is_soft404`, `body_similarity`) to get retry-on-transient-
failure, soft-404 filtering, and content-similarity comparison for free.
